Taliban executes 5 Afghan forces in a desert court in Farah
Taliban insurgents have executed five Afghan forces and a civilian in a desert court in western Farah province, local officials said.

Mohammad Malyar a security official in Farah police HQ told Raha that Taliban insurgents on Monday executed five Afghan forces and a civilian in a desert court in Bakwa district of the western Farah province.
He said there were three Afghan national army soldiers and two police soldiers who were executed by Taliban militants.
Police launched investigation into the incident to arrest those being guilty. Said Malyar.
Taliban militants however have yet to make any comments on the report.
It is not the first time that Taliban militants execute Afghan forces in desert courts across the country.
